Linda Campbell could hardly believe it when her homeowners association told her she couldn't park her new electric car in the garage outside her townhome or plug it in to a nearby outlet.
Even more surprising, she thought, given that she lives on downtown Denver's western edge in a community that brags about its access to light rail and buses.
"The HOA admitted this was a whole new world, that there was no mention of electric cars in the regulations," Campbell said.
